Design and Build Quality

The Excalibur 3926TB features a sturdy ABS plastic body with a clear polycarbonate door that lets you monitor drying progress without opening. The nine trays slide out smoothly and are made of durable, BPA-free plastic. The rear-mounted fan and horizontal airflow design is a standout, eliminating the need to rotate trays during drying. The control panel includes a dial for temperature and a digital timer with up to 26 hours. The unit is heavy and solid, but its large footprint (17.5 x 12.5 x 19.5 inches) requires dedicated counter space. The door hinges are reinforced and the trays have a slight lip to prevent small items from falling off. The overall construction feels premium, though some users have noted that the plastic can scratch if handled roughly.

Drying Performance

Performance is where the Excalibur 3926TB shines. The 600-watt motor and rear fan distribute heat evenly across all trays, resulting in consistent drying without hot spots. For jerky, the adjustable thermostat (85-165°F) allows precise control for safe meat drying. Fruit leather dries evenly without sticking, and herbs retain their color and flavor at low temperatures. The timer is a major convenience for overnight or long drying sessions. However, the unit does not have an automatic shutoff; the timer only stops the fan and heater, so you must turn the dial to off manually. In practice, this means if you set the timer for 8 hours and leave, the unit will stop heating and fanning after 8 hours but remain powered on. This is a minor inconvenience but does not affect drying results. The airflow is so even that you can load all nine trays with different foods without flavor transfer, as long as you avoid strong odors like garlic or fish.

Cleaning and Maintenance

Cleaning the trays requires hand washing with warm soapy water. They are not dishwasher safe, which is a drawback for some. The door and interior can be wiped with a damp cloth. The mesh sheets for fruit leather and small items are sold separately and also need hand washing. With proper care, the unit remains in good condition for years. The trays have a smooth surface that resists sticking, but if you dry sticky foods like fruit leather without a liner, you may need to soak the trays. The rear fan area should be kept clear of debris; occasional vacuuming of the intake vent helps maintain airflow. Some users recommend using a soft brush to clean the fan grille.

Accessories and Expandability

The Excalibur 3926TB is compatible with a range of optional accessories, including ParaFlexx non-stick sheets for fruit leather, mesh screens for small items like herbs and seeds, and additional trays (up to 15 total with an optional expansion kit). The expansion kit allows you to stack extra trays, increasing capacity to about 25 square feet. This modularity makes the unit scalable for large harvests or bulk processing. The accessories are sold separately and are available directly from Excalibur or third-party retailers. The clear door is also available as a replacement part if damaged. Overall, the ability to customize the setup is a strong selling point for serious users.

Questions before you buy

Can the Excalibur 3926TB be used for making jerky?

Yes, it excels at jerky. The adjustable thermostat allows you to set the temperature between 145°F and 165°F, which is ideal for safely drying meat. The horizontal airflow ensures even drying without rotating trays.

Is the timer automatic shutoff or just a timer?

The timer will stop the unit after the set time, but it does not have an automatic shutoff feature that turns off the dehydrator completely. You must manually turn the dial to off after the timer stops.

Are the trays dishwasher safe?

No, the trays are not dishwasher safe. They should be hand washed with warm soapy water. The door and body can be wiped clean with a damp cloth.

How noisy is the Excalibur 3926TB?

It produces a constant hum around 50-55 dB, which is noticeable but not disruptive. Some users find it louder than expected, especially in open kitchens.

Can I dry herbs at low temperatures with this model?

Yes, the thermostat goes down to 85°F, which is perfect for herbs. The low temperature preserves essential oils and flavor, and the even airflow prevents scorching.

Does the Excalibur 3926TB come with fruit leather sheets?

No, fruit leather sheets and mesh screens for small items are sold separately. The standard trays have a solid surface with small holes, but for fruit leather you will need the optional ParaFlexx sheets or similar non-stick inserts.

How long does it typically take to dry jerky in this dehydrator?

Drying time for jerky varies by thickness and moisture content, but generally takes 4 to 6 hours at 155°F to 165°F. Thicker cuts or higher moisture marinades may require up to 8 hours. The timer allows you to set it and check periodically.
